Output 37c6fde3056c263864022d53e6a1f4173719705b9369bc86b07ffd29e73ac274:1

value
6275043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ae106730278d84528e304ae491d3af6137532f OP_EQUAL
address
35DY81xE37Qx43hCF5XSNnjQwDp3tDJpfo
transaction
37c6fde3056c263864022d53e6a1f4173719705b9369bc86b07ffd29e73ac274
confirmations
290372
spent
true